The children’s workforce needs innovative and creative leaders who are confident in working with diverse communities to promote social justice. This distance learning programme empowers you to transform the lives of children, young people and families, by working together to make social change.
Why study MA Childhood and Education in Diverse Societies at Middlesex University?
An MA in Childhood and Education in Diverse Societies will prepare you for working with children, young people and families and become a leader for social change in the context of diverse societies.
This course is ideal for graduates with an interest in working with children and families, or taking a role within formal education who have a strong sense of community and want to explore how to make real social change through their work.
We welcome students from a variety of backgrounds and subjects, as long as you have a passion for education and change.
